Mineral Processing and Extractive Metallurgy is devoted to scientific, engineering, and economic aspects of the preparation, separation, extraction, and purification of ores, metals, and mineral products by both physical and chemical methods. Gold (Au) melts at a temperature of 1,064° C (1,947° F). Its relatively high density (19.3 grams per cubic centimetre) has made it amenable to recovery by placer mining and gravity concentration techniques.

Mining, mineral processing and metal extraction are undergoing a profound transformation as a result of two revolutions in the making—one, advances in digital technologies and the other, availability of electricity from renewable energy sources at affordable prices. Mineral processing, art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ock, or gangue. It is the first process that most ores undergo after mining in order to provide a more concentrated material for the procedures of extractive metallurgy.
